  • Reporter John Lobertini takes us to meet a Utah ranching family where sheep, snowmobiles and horses are part of a family operation thats been honored for protecting the environment. Reporter Akiba Howard visits a Nebraska farm where a young couple has decided to make their future on the land. Reporter Sarah Gardner discovers that a "better chicken" comes from research that ultimately affects dinner on your table. Reporter Rob Stewart finds a New England company bringing the past to life in restoring Americas historic barns.

      Artificial selection and genetic engineering are very different. Artificial selection by humans has been going on since the dawn of agriculture. This involves crossbreeding of animals and plants and selecting the ones with the desired traits. Genetic engineering however, splices in genes from completely different species.....for instance, introducing a cold tolerance gene from trout, into a tomato.....that is something that could never happen in nature. That's what people take issue with.
